April - Polar Bear Plunge
OK so it’s not New Years Day where some crazy people traditionally plunge in waters somewhere in really really cold weather. However, those in the know about Seneca Lake can verify that Seneca itself is really really COLD year around. In part 600 feet deep and a couple of miles wide, this glacier carved lake never freezes. June 8 - Sahlen’s Six Hours of the Glen
Watkins Glen International race car track hosts this Sports Car Series event. WGI’s race car traditions stem from the ‘early’ Grand Prix races with legends like Nikki Lauda, Mario Andretti, and Mark Donahue. The 1952 built road course on the ‘hill’ retains the twists and turns but has added huge upgrades over the years and installed state of the art communications. For WGI schedules, tickets and info visit www.theglen.com During down time (no scheduled events) at WGI, in a “vehicle with 4 wheels” and $30.00 per car, you as well, can get the ‘feel’ of racing car greats, as you take the turns and straights for three laps at the ‘The Glen’.

September 5-7th weekend. Watkins Glen Vintage Grand Prix Festival
Come early on Friday the 5th to catch the sounds of motor racing echoing through the streets and in the hills as it was in ‘The Glen’ from 1948 to 1952 Grand Prix racing. With names like Bugati or USRRC/CanAm or Maserati and Porsche…one doesn’t have to be a ‘race officiando’ to appreciate the design and craft of these motor machines of yesteryear. Three laps through the streets of Watkins Glen and up through the hills, the cars return through historic Milliken’s Corner to race down the main straight, to the finish line. Contact the International Motor Racing Research Center in Watkins Glen for details www.racingarchives.org The Center has self-directed brochure maps of the original road course circuit through Watkins and the surrounding country side.
